Answer:

Many of Da Vinci’s famous paintings are incredibly realistic. His scientific observations helped him get the proportions right, and all the small details. There’s another aspect of his compositions that relied on scientific study: light. Starting from an interest in perspective, Da Vinci moved on to the study of optics and light.
